How do I know if the ECM is bad and not just a sensor?

Start by checking power, ground, and basic wiring to the ECM. If those are solid and the truck still has no-start, shutdown, or communication problems, especially after sensor replacements, the Celect Plus ECM becomes a strong suspect.

When a Celect Plus ECM May Be at Fault

On a Cummins N14 Celect Plus engine, the ECM monitors and controls fuel delivery, injection timing, engine protection strategies, and communication with the rest of the truck. Internal ECM issues often show up as:

  • Crank–no start: The engine cranks, but will not fire even though fuel and basic sensors have been checked.
  • Intermittent starting: The truck may start when cold but fail to restart when hot or after a short shutdown.
  • Sudden engine shutdowns: The engine cuts off without warning and may restart after sitting or cooling.
  • Loss of power under load: Noticeable reduction in pulling power, especially on grades or while towing.
  • No communication with the ECM: Diagnostic tools cannot connect to the Celect Plus controller, even when powers and grounds appear correct.
  • Recurring or conflicting fault codes: Codes that move around, return quickly after clearing, or do not match the truck-side findings.

Once wiring, batteries, grounds, and external sensors have been verified, a failing Celect Plus ECM becomes a likely cause of these patterns.


Why Cummins N14 Celect Plus ECMs Fail

N14 Celect Plus ECMs operate for years in hot, high-vibration environments. Common contributors to failure include:

  • Thermal stress: Repeated heating and cooling cycles slowly weaken solder joints and stress components.
  • Vibration: Constant vibration from the engine and chassis can fatigue internal connections and heavier components.
  • Electrical spikes: Low voltage events, weak batteries, poor grounds, and jump-starts can strain voltage regulators and driver circuits.
  • Age-related wear: Over time, capacitors and other parts drift out of specification or fail outright.
  • Moisture and contamination: Moisture entering connectors or the housing can promote corrosion and intermittent faults.

These factors tend to start as intermittent problems and eventually progress into hard failures if not addressed.


What Is Included in Our Celect Plus ECM Repair

Our repair process is designed specifically around common Celect Plus failure modes. Each ECM goes through:

  • Internal visual inspection: The ECM is opened and examined for heat damage, corrosion, and previous repair attempts.
  • Power and ground circuit testing: Internal power rails and ground networks are verified under load.
  • Logic and driver circuit evaluation: Circuits involved in fueling, timing, and communication are tested for weak or failed components.
  • Component replacement: Faulty or out-of-spec components are replaced with appropriate replacements.
  • Solder rework: Cracked or stressed joints in high-risk areas are reflowed or rebuilt.
  • Board cleaning: Residues and contamination are removed to help prevent future corrosion issues.
  • Bench testing: The repaired ECM is powered and monitored on the bench for stable operation before return shipping.

If the ECM arrives with extensive physical damage, burnt sections, or heavy corrosion that prevents a reliable repair, we will contact you before proceeding.
